Matt Arsenault 0e1c71e4a4 CodeGen: Move getAddressSpaceForPseudoSourceKind into TargetMachine
Avoid the dependency on TargetInstrInfo, which depends on the subtarget
and therefore the individual function.

Currently AMDGPU is constructing PseudoSourceValue instances in MachineFunctionInfo.
In order to facilitate copying MachineFunctionInfo, we need to stop allocating these
there. Alternatively we could allow targets to subclass PseudoSourceValueManager,
and allocate them similarly to MachineFunctionInfo.

/// \file
/// Implementation of AMDGPU overrides of MIRFormatter.
//
//===----------------------------------------------------------------------===//
#include "AMDGPUMIRFormatter.h"
#include "GCNSubtarget.h"
#include "SIMachineFunctionInfo.h"
using namespace llvm;
bool AMDGPUMIRFormatter::parseCustomPseudoSourceValue(
StringRef Src, MachineFunction &MF, PerFunctionMIParsingState &PFS,
const PseudoSourceValue *&PSV, ErrorCallbackType ErrorCallback) const {
SIMachineFunctionInfo *MFI = MF.getInfo<SIMachineFunctionInfo>();
const AMDGPUTargetMachine &TM =
static_cast<const AMDGPUTargetMachine &>(MF.getTarget());
if (Src == "BufferResource") {
PSV = MFI->getBufferPSV(TM);
return false;
}
if (Src == "ImageResource") {
PSV = MFI->getImagePSV(TM);
return false;
}
if (Src == "GWSResource") {
PSV = MFI->getGWSPSV(TM);
return false;
}
llvm_unreachable("unknown MIR custom pseudo source value");
}
